文章

43

粉丝

1

获赞

85

访问

1.9k

头像
日期 题解:计算天数
P1011 贵州大学机试题
发布于2026年3月15日 14:43
阅读数 25

#include <iostream>
#include <string>
using namespace std;

int main(){
	int m,d;
	
	int month[13] = {0,31,29,31,30,31,30,31,31,30,31,30,31};
	
	string week[7] = {
       "Sunday","Monday","Tuesday","Wednesday","Thursday","Friday","Saturday"
    };
	
	while(cin >> m >> d){
		int days = 0;
		
		for(int i=4;i < m;i++){
			days += month[i];
		}
		days += d - 12;
		
		int start =4;
		cout << week[(start+days)%7] << endl;
		}
	return 0;
}

 

登录查看完整内容


登录后发布评论

暂无评论,来抢沙发